w alaikum salam
I tested the pixelizer module with this ROM and found that DT2W is working well but module is a little bit inconsistent with the ROM. Initially I had to force reboot my phone once due to System UI getting into bootloop while setting up (no more such issue since then).
I was surprised to see that all kernel governors are stuck at top speed hence, I had a battery drop of massive 35% overnight despite using bioshock governor and switching all sensors off before sleeping :eek: I tried a few governors and found that smartmax is working well. It is keeping the CPU at slow speed and maxes up when needed. Moreover, my P2 has enjoyed deepsleep of 50+ minutes this morning despite using it randomly.
